Output 18ec186ce022af0d6e9ff1676b4f5464b31c1100999254082a9dc3db9126c95f:1

value
724192695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d2eabbc1de784099face5cdb4906e29233e44a4 OP_EQUAL
address
34MKRrTjeELg8oxuRw17Mm4V1Far7hfHmz
transaction
18ec186ce022af0d6e9ff1676b4f5464b31c1100999254082a9dc3db9126c95f
spent
true